Measurements of Mixed-Mode Crack Surface Displacements and Comparison With TheorySource: Journal of Applied Mechanics:;1980:;volume( 047 ):;issue: 003::page 557DOI: 10.1115/1.3153731Publisher: The American Society of Mechanical Engineers (ASME)
Abstract: The problem of a finite-width tension specimen containing a crack oriented at various angles to the load axis is attacked from experimental and theoretical viewpoints. Displacements of an electro-machined slot, 12.5 mm long and oriented at angles of 0°, 15°, 30°, 45°, 60°, and 75°, are measured using a laser-based in-plane measuring technique. Various width specimens, ranging from a crack-length/width ratio of 0.167 to 0.794, are tested. A boundary-integral equation method is extended to deal with the presence of a sharp crack. Agreement between the two approaches is generally good except near the tips of the cracks.
